That way you can ensure full travel of the spool. | | | | | Joined: Oct 2010 Posts: 62 Wrench Fetcher | | Wrench Fetcher Joined: Oct 2010 Posts: 62 | MC Bleed Try this..... pull the brake lines off, run a small tube around and back in the fluid, SLOWLY pump the pedal till no more air bubbles are seen. This takes care of the MC, ya still gotta check the wheel cylinders. Don J  | | | | | Joined: Aug 2005 Posts: 6,377 Ex Hall Monitor | | Ex Hall Monitor Joined: Aug 2005 Posts: 6,377 | I just replaced the master cylinder on my '38. I didn't bench bleed it but it wasn't much of a chore doing it the "normal" way. I've read that a master cylinder will self bleed and that was my experience. We did a standard bleed until we got no more air from the fittings. I had good pedal but by the time I got home after driving home through town I ended up with the best pedal I've ever had on the car. Rock solid with only 1-2" of travel to full lock up.
